AgCO is a ceramic compound containing silver and carbon/oxygen components, representing a material class that bridges metallic and ceramic properties through its mixed composition. While AgCO itself is not commonly encountered in mainstream industrial applications, silver-bearing ceramic compounds are of research interest for specialized applications requiring antimicrobial action, electrical conductivity in ceramic matrices, or catalytic properties. The material's position in the ceramic family suggests potential use in niche applications where silver's bioactive or conductive characteristics are needed in a thermally stable ceramic matrix.
